Dear Teacher: During the What About Whales assembly program one of our education staff members will introduce students to several whale and dolphin species found in Pacific waters. Using a PowerPoint presentation, life-sized inflatable whales, bones, teeth and baleen, students will learn characteristics of marine mammals and understand the differences between toothed and baleen whales. Before your assembly program: Ask students to list the characteristics of mammals and give examples. Compare the living conditions of a marine mammal with those of a terrestrial mammal. Where do they sleep? How do they get their food? What do they eat? What environmental conditions must they be adapted to? Compare and contrast humans and whales in the Where Do Whales Fit In? activity. Conduct the Measuring Whales activity. Using a tape measure, have your students measure out the length of each animal. After your assembly program: Conduct the Where Do Whales Fit In? activity again to see if students’ thing of additional classification characteristics. Conduct the The Wonder of Blubber activity to discuss one of many whale adaptations for life in the ocean. Lead a classroom discussion using the enclosed Dilemmas card activity. Review the difference between endangered and threatened species with your class. Several species of whales (sei, fin, sperm, blue, humpback and right) are currently listed as endangered in the state of Oregon. Ask students to consider what actions they can take to prevent further loss of these species. David Allan Abstract Estuarine responses to nutrient loads can be remarkably different. Many driving variables including light, water residence time, physical stratification, and temperature are responsible for the diversity of the response. To classify estuaries based on their susceptibility to nutrient loads, a nutrient- phytoplankton- zooplankton (NPZ) model was developed and applied to river-dominated, well-mixed estuaries. Estuaries are classified as having low, medium, high and hyper eutrophic conditions by the model. The result of the model suggests that water residence time is an important controlling variable in the process of achieving a steady-state response to nutrient loads. Although phytoplankton responses to residence time vary under different loads, they have the same positive trend. Phytoplankton responses are almost linear with water residence time initially, then decrease, and eventually plateau. i Table of Contents Part1. Small PREFACE The Columbia River Estuarv Data Development Program This document is one of a set of publications and other materials produced by the Columbia River Estuary Data Development Program (CREDDP). CREDDP has two purposes: to increase understanding of the ecology of the Columbia River Estuary and to provide information useful in making land and water use decisions. The program was initiated by local governments and citizens who saw a need for a better information base for use in managing natural resources and in planning for development. In response to these concerns, the Governors of the states of Oregon and Washington requested in 1974 that the Pacific Northwest River Basins Commission (PNRBC) undertake an interdisciplinary ecological study of the estuary. At approximately the same time, local governments and port districts formed the Columbia River Estuary Study Taskforce (CREST) to develop a regional management plan for the estuary.
